Yahoo to lay off around 1,500 workers
Rumors are confirmed as Yahoo has announced that they would be cutting around 1500 jobs in their worldwide operations.
This job cut would mean that the company would get rid of 10% of their entire workforce.
The company has just come out with their latest revenue report and the numbers are not good.
Yahoo revealed that their revenues in the quarter were around $1.79 billion. The operating income was just around $70 million.
Yahoo said that they are now aiming to cut its current annual costs of about $3.9 billion by more than $400 million before the end of the year.
Jerry Yang, co-founder and chief executive officer of Yahoo said: “The steps we are taking this quarter should deliver not only near-term benefits to operating cash flow, but should also substantially enhance the nimbleness and flexibility with which we compete over the long term.”
